‘Essence’ by Wizkid is currently 4X platinum in the US
‘Essence’ by Wizkid is currently 4X platinum in the US ‘Essence’ by Wizkid wins a four-time RIAA platinum plaque. “Essence,” a song from Wizkid’s fourth album “Made In Lagos,” became one of the most popular Afrobeats tracks exported worldwide after experiencing enormous international success. Another achievement is that “Essence” has sold more over four million units in the US, earning it a platinum plaque from the RIAA. ‘Essence’ featuring Tems has been commercially successful since its release in 2020, particularly in the US where the Justin Bieber remix helped it…
Nigeria will host the Headies Awards again following two international editions
Nigeria will host the Headies Awards again following two international editions Headies Award goes back to its hometown. The Headies Awards make a comeback to Nigeria following two global iterations. One of the most prominent music awards in Nigeria, the Headies Awards has helped to develop the country’s music sector. According to recent announcements from the Headies Academy, the renowned award will make its way back to Nigeria in 2024 following two editions in Atlanta, USA. The Headies Academy announced the news in a press release on February 7, 2024.…
